Shraddha Kapoor Writes Songs Too

Darpan News Desk IANS, 08 Nov, 2016 11:39 AM
    Actress Shraddha Kapoor says along with singing, she writes songs as well.
     
    Shraddha told IANS: "Apart from singing, I also write my own songs. I have never said this before, but I have been writing for a while now. I have been writing my own lyrics."
     
    The actress, who has sung tracks like "Galliyan" and "Udja re" in her own films, isn't sure about lending her voice to other actresses. 
     
    "I think I am happy singing for myself. But never say never for anything."
     
    She will next be seen on the big screen with actor-filmmaker Farhan Akhtar in "Rock On 2". She says she would like to be directed by him.
     
    "'Dil Chahta Hai' is one of my favourite films. I also loved 'Lakshya'. As a co-star, he is so passionate on sets. When he is an actor, he is only that. So, it's nice to see that. He is so talented," Shraddha said.
     
    Directed by Shujaat Saudagar, the film is set to release on Friday.
